by Auria
Some ideas : use vertex colors to make the inside-most part of the cave darker
Then you could add some plants or other stuff on the brown walls to make them more interesting, and plants on the ground too. You could easily re-use models from other tracks for the plants
And look at the screenshots I attached.
In quads.jpg, we can easily see that each quad is textured independently, resulting in visible lines where the texture is not smooth. If you learn better texturing techniques you can fix this
In bricks.jpg, we can see the bricks at the top are cut off. Try moving the texture so that the top edge is exactly between 2 brick layer

by cheesebrother
Thanks for pointing out the errors and giving suggestions. Here are some shots of the improvements that i've made. As you can see ive set new textures for the castle, the bridge, and the fence. I placed it properly so that it's pretty much seamless around the circle. Also, the water runs into a cavish thingy which looks a whole lot better than it did before. In the other pic i've darkened the inside of the tunnel. Near in the picture it's dark and then at the entrance it gets a bit lighter and then at the very entrance it's the shade of the dirt outside. I'll need to see about plants, trying to find good models or might make one myself. Another thing that i'll do is to put a plane beneath the water which resets the kart. That way you'll get a splash when you hit the water but won't be reset until the kart is partly submerged.
